Dirt Tubes: Pencil-sized dirt tunnels on the foundation walls, crawl space, or floors joists. These are roads worker termites use to travel among their nest as well as your home. Discarded Wings: After a pest swarm (often within spring), you may possibly find piles associated with discarded translucent wings near windows, doors, or light features.

Frass: Small, pellet-like droppings that seem like sawdust, often found near damaged solid wood. Hollow-Sounding Wood: Faucet on wooden floors; if they noise hollow, it could indicate termite harm. Blistering or Darkened Wood: Termites can cause wood floors to blister or even appear darkened because they tunnel just underneath the top. Sagging Flooring surfaces or Ceilings: In severe cases, substantial damage can lead to structural concerns.
